What are some basic courses you will get to attend in a German business university?

Business Statistics, Principles of Organisation, HR Management, Principles of Economics, Management and Leadership are some of the most basic courses you will attend at a Business University in Germany.

What are some of the reasons students choose a Business Degree in Germany?

Learning the German language, having options for funding opportunities, an unforgettable study experience and affordable tuition fees are some of the reasons Business in Germany is a very popular degree for international students.
